Grade 3J1
Old Grade
Corresponding Standard YB /T 5256-2011
3J1 and 3J53 alloy for elastic component
Classification Alloy Steel
Properties Elasticity Corrosion Resistance
Density 8 g/cm3
3J1 Chemical Element Composition Content (%)
Component C Si Mn P S Cr Ni Ti Al More
Minimum Value - - - - - 11.5 34.5 2.7 1 Fe:Remainder
Maximum Value 0.05 0.8 1 0.02 0.02 13 36.5 3.2 1.8
Foreign brand/standard: 36НХТЮ(36NKHTYU) /GOST 14119
